硬件课程设计报告---可存储式电子琴
《硬件课程设计报告---可存储式电子琴》由会员分享,可在线阅读,更多相关《硬件课程设计报告---可存储式电子琴(45页珍藏版)》请在毕设资料网上搜索。
1、- 1 - 计算机科学与技术学院 硬件课程设计 个人报告 设计题目:设计题目: 可存储式电子琴 二一二年十二月二十七日二一二年十二月二十七日 - 2 - 摘 要 在这次的硬件实验中, 我们利用学习的微机原理与接口技术这门课程课上 我们学到的一些计算机硬件工作的基本原理, 汇编语言程序设计方法,微型 计算机接口技术,建立微型计算机系统的整体概念,初步形成微机系统软硬件 开发的能力。为了能够学以致用,同时也为了更深入的了解熟悉可编程定时器 8253 和 8279。在汇编语言环境下,利用上述两种芯片,编程让 8279 通过识别 键盘产生键值,8253 识别发声从而实现计算机按照按键的不同而发出不同频
2、 率的声音。 可存储式电子琴可用于设计小型发声玩具, 由于本电子琴设计简单, 稍加修改便可用于其它地方,如报警防盗器部件,音乐门铃等,具有一定的商 业价值。 本次硬件课程设计课程,是配合上学期微型计算机原理与接口技术的 教学,也是要让我们能够更深入的认识接口芯片技术以及汇编编程,做到理论 和实践相结合。 在课程中,我们选择的设计项目是“可存储式电子琴” :一个简易的电子琴 设备。要求我们利用相关已经学过的和没有学过的芯片连接成一个电子电路, 并且通过自己用汇编语言编程,控制设计的电子电路实现电子琴的一些功能, 比如:能够对于输入发出相应的单声;能够演奏一小段已经编好了的乐曲。 关键词: 可存储
3、电子琴 8279 8253 门控信号 程序代码 - 3 - 目目 录录 1 1 开发背景开发背景 . 3 2 2 产品功能及涉及的芯片和硬件产品功能及涉及的芯片和硬件 3 2.1 功能简介 3 2.2 使用的主要芯片及元件 3 2.3 各音阶频率值 . 错误错误! !未定义书签。未定义书签。 2.4 可编程计数器/定时器 8253 . 4 2.4.1 8253 内部结构和引脚 4 2.4.2 8253 方式控制字格式. 错误错误! !未定义书签。未定义书签。 2.4.3 8253 的工作方式 3方波发生器 5 2.4.4 本设计中 8253 的功能 错误错误! !未定义书签。未定义书签。 2.
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中设计图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 硬件 课程设计 报告 存储 电子琴
